c语言中优先级最高的运算符
C语言中优先级最高的运算符是括号。括号的作用是改变运算的优先级,使得在表达式中括号内的运算先于括号外的运算。
在C语言中,运算符的优先级是由高到低排列的,而括号的优先级最高,因此在表达式中出现括号时,括号内的运算会先于括号外的运算进行。这种特性使得括号成为了C语言中最重要的运算符之一。
括号的使用非常灵活,可以用于各种类型的表达式,包括算术表达式、逻辑表达式、条件表达式等。例如,在处理复杂的算术表达式时,使用括号可以明确运算的优先级,避免出现错误的结果。
在编写函数时,括号也是一个非常重要的组成部分。函数的参数通常会用括号括起来,以便明确参数的传递方式和顺序。例如,下面是一个简单的函数定义:
```
int add(int a, int b) {
运算符优先级按从高到低排列    return a + b;
}
```
在这个函数定义中,括号内的参数列表表明了这个函数需要接受两个整型参数,分别是a和b。这些参数将会被函数体内的代码使用。
除了括号,C语言中还有其他优先级较高的运算符,例如逻辑非(!)、取地址(&)、指针引用(*)等。这些运算符都有着特殊的作用,可以用于不同类型的表达式中。但是,相对于括号而言,它们的使用频率较低,而且在表达式中使用时也需要特别小心,以避免出现错误的结果。
在编写C语言程序时,正确地使用括号是非常重要的。括号可以使程序的逻辑更加清晰,代码更加易于维护和调试。因此,我们应该在编写代码时养成良好的习惯,及时使用括号,以便提高程序的可读性和可靠性。
括号是C语言中优先级最高的运算符之一,它的作用是改变表达式中运算的优先级,使得括号内的运算先于括号外的运算进行。正确地使用括号可以使程序的逻辑更加清晰,代码更加易于维护和调试。在编写C语言程序时,我们应该养成良好的习惯,及时使用括号,以提高程序的可读性和可靠性。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。